Hey there doctorjazz!
the HA-2 continues the value/performance/intelligent design of Oppo products.  I've had mine since they first came out. see
the column Katz's corner (not me) on innerfidelity.com for detailed review and rave praise. thin, well finished in leather, and
plenty of power to connect from your smartphone via mini usb or from your DAP via 3.5 for extra power, it has a slightly warm
tone and great dynamics, and can power Oppo PM3 headphones to satisfying levels of dynamics and detail without distortion.
form factor makes it slick for sliding in jeans pockets or breast pocket (much more than a Mojo) and Oppo customer service
a pleasure to deal with for order and followup.  highly recommended.
